nm_rcarrier_fsm: Trigger S_NM_RUNNING_CHG when Admin st changes in op=Enabled

It was described in [1] that the NM FSM failed to trigger the
S_NM_RUNNNG_CHG signal when locking/unlocking the TRX.
That's because current osmo-bts doesn't fully conform to TS 52.021 and
it doesn't go back to Op=Disabled Avail=Dependency when becoming
Admin=Locked. It's true though that TS 52.021 sec 5.3.1 is not really
helpful since it doesn't explicitly state that specific object should go
into Disabled Dependency, despite saying it for most of the other ones.
Hence, let's account for both possibilities at the BSC side.
